/ Juergen Kulka talked about the future of facilities management at Visionaries Lecture Series in Adu Dhabi.

 

Juergen Kulka talked about the future of facilities management. The subject covered a broad spectrum of disciplines; and it is the co-ordination and management of these services and their suppliers that gives us the need for facilities management.

A good Facilities Manager will bring together the specialists, build relationships with them and act as a focal point for both client and end user. It is essential they are good business managers

as their in-depth understanding of their organisation’s business is critical.

The fundamentals of facilities management are constantly being rethought with new ideas and theoretical approaches to ensure that it is planned, organised and implemented to match the organisational need.
